Consultation has concluded

We asought community feedback on a draft nine year lease for the Minister of Police (SAPOL) to program, manage and maintain the relocated Road Safety Centre (mock roadway) as a part of Council's Bonython Park Activity Hub.

Six submissions were received with five of these supportive of Council issuing a lease to the State Government for the Road Safety Centre in Bonython Park. The SAPOL Road Saftey Centre lease has been finalised and signed off as per the conditions that were consulted on.
Construction of the Road Safety Centre bicycle track will commence after Easter, with use of the facility anticipated to commence in Term 3 this year.
